On arrival in the UK the squadron absorbed part of 1849 squadron, re-equipping with 24 aircraft.
In February 1945 the squadron embarked on HMS Venerable for DLT, two weeks later embarking on HMS Vengeance for the British Pacific Fleet.

In June 1945 the squadron became part of the 13th Carrier Air Group at Tambaram, embarking from Jervis Bay on HMS Vengeance two days before VJ-Day, however the squadron remained on active duty till October 1945.
